quadrilateral abcd has coordinates A(-5,4),B(0,6),C(3,-1), and D(-2,-3). Use the midpoint formula to determine if the figure is a parallelogram and why.

To solve this problem you must apply the proccedure shown below:

1. You have that the 1uadrilateral abcd has coordinates A(-5,4),B(0,6),C(3,-1), and D(-2,-3).

2. Now, you must apply the formula for calculate the midpoint, which is:

M=(x2+x1/2, y2+y1/2)

3. Therefore, you have:

M1=(3+(-5)/2, -1+4/2)
M1=(-2/2, 3/2)
M1=(-1,3/2)

M2=(-2+0/2, -3+6/2)
M2=(-1, 3/2)

M1=M2

4. Then the answer is:

The figure is a parallelogram, because its diagonals bisect each other.
